A family member grapples with concerning investment choices in the world of meme coins. Amid rising talk of significant returns, questions arise on the legitimacy of such trades, leaving families anxious over financial futures.
Reports have surfaced of a young investor engaging in coin trading with friends, experiencing substantial gains. Users on forums caution that deals which sound too good to be true often are. "If itβs too good to be trueβ¦" cautioned one commenter, echoing a prevalent sentiment.
The chatter reveals several themes:
Risk of Greed: One user noted the importance of taking profits at reasonable increments to avoid losses. Many fall victim to their greed, leaving them vulnerable in the volatile crypto market.
Meme Coins in Focus: A growing interest in meme coins on platforms like Axiom, with some advising that these trades can be profitable if executed wisely. Others warn of potential pitfalls, suggesting that the environment can go from profitable to perilous quickly.
Insider Trading Concerns: Thereβs speculation that certain investors may have access to privileged information, boosting their profit margins at the expense of the uninformed. "His buddy is probably in an insider group that pumps coins Happens every day," pointed out a concerned party.

Thereβs a strong chance that as the popularity of meme coins continues to rise, regulatory scrutiny will also increase. Experts estimate around 60% of active traders may face challenges as government agencies look to standardize practices in this space. This could involve creating clearer guidelines around trading and marketing these coins to protect less-informed investors. Additionally, many in the community may either adapt to these changes or withdraw, leading to a wider gap between knowledgeable traders and casual participants. The anxiety surrounding scams could prompt a more cautious approach, but profits might still lure those willing to take risks, ensuring a varied landscape for trading in the months to come.
Interestingly, this situation mirrors the 19th-century gold rush, where hopeful miners flocked to California, chasing wealth in a rush fueled by speculation. Just as many rushed in without understanding the terrain, todayβs traders dive into meme coins, often lured by stories of quick cash. While some struck it rich, many faced significant losses, leading to a boom and bust cycle reminiscent of todayβs crypto trading. This historical parallel could serve as a cautionary tale, reminding todayβs investors that not every shiny opportunity leads to lasting treasures.
